JUNO Reference Orientation CK File for Gravity Science Passes ============================================================= Created on November 2, 2016 by Ben Bradley, JPL. Summary ------------------------------------------------------------- This file contains a reference attitude profile using MWR Tilt science passes for the new reference SPK (53-day orbits). The CK starts just before PJ2 and runs until PJ22 after the de-orbit burn. Start: 29 AUG 2016 09:00:00.000 UTC Stop : 12 SEP 2019 20:14:40.000 UTC Implementation Notes ------------------------------------------------------------- The JUNO_SPACECRAFT orientation is provided in this file using a combination of two kinds of segments: - segments providing the orientation of the JUNO spin axis (+Z) encapsulated in the orientation of the JUNO_SPIN_AXIS frame (frame ID -61900) relative to the J2000 inertial frame. These segments were generated using SPICE utility program "prediCkt" based on the spin axis pointing profile from the source e-mail. See Appendix 1 below for more details about these segments ("prediCkt" inputs, fit accuracy, etc.) - segments providing the rotation of the spacecraft about the spin axis encapsulated in the orientation of the JUNO_SPACECRAFT frame (frame ID -61000) relative to the JUNO_SPIN_AXIS frame. These segments were generated using SPICE utility program "msopck" based on the rotation profile from the source e-mail. See Appendix 2 below for details about these segments ("msopck" setup parameters, input, etc.). The segments generated by "prediCkt" and "msopck" were merged together into a single file (this file) using SPICE utility "dafcat". After merging the file was augmented with these comments. Modeling Notes ------------------------------------------------------------- Users of this CK file should be aware that: - the time-lines in the source spreadsheet did not include Earth-repointing precessions - the spin axis pointing (+Z of the JUNO_SPIN_AXIS frame) was modeled to be within 0.25 degrees of JUNO-Earth, or JUNO-Anti Orbital Momentum Vector (depending of the attitude mode). The ZX plane of the JUNO_SPIN_AXIS frame was modeled to always contain Ecliptic North, with the +X axis to be as close to it as possible. Directions ----------------------------------------------------------------- The directions defined in this section are based on the descriptions from sheet 3 of the spreadsheet. TOSUN is the geometric position of the Sun relative to JUNO. TOEARTH is the geometric position of the Earth relative to JUNO. JUNOPOS is the geometric position of JUNO relative to Jupiter. JUNOVEL is the geometric velocity of JUNO relative to Jupiter. JUNOORB is the JUNO orbital momentum vector computed as the cross product of the JUNO position and velocity relative to Jupiter. JUNOORB14 is the JUNO orbital momentum vector rotated by -14 degrees about JUNOPOS. ECLIPN is the +Z axis (North pole) of the Ecliptic of J2000 inertial frame (ECLIPJ2000). JOIZ is the reference direction for +Z axis during JOI burn -- RA=268.422 deg, Dec=62.359 deg in EME2000. PRMZ is the reference direction for +Z axis during PRM burn -- RA=268.381 deg, Dec=60.061 deg in EME2000. DEORBITZ is the reference direction for +Z axis during the Deorbit burn -- RA=76.668 deg, Dec=-42.089 deg in EME2000. ORBXEARTH is the vector normal to the TOEARTH and JUNOORB vectors in the direction of Jupiter's +Z body axis HALFMWR is an intermediate vector between the TOSUN and -JUNOORB vectors. SUNPOINTED orientation has +Z along direction from JUNO to the Sun and Ecliptic North pole defining the ZX plane. EARTHPOINTED orientation has +Z along direction from JUNO to the Earth and Ecliptic North pole defining the ZX plane. MWRATTITUDE orientation has -Z along JUNO orbital momentum vector (POS cross VEL) and Ecliptic North pole defining the ZX plane. MWRATTITUDETILT14 orientation has -Z along JUNO orbital momentum vector (POS cross VEL) rotated by -14 degrees about POS and Ecliptic North pole defining the ZX plane. JOIBURN orientation has +Z along the reference direction during the JOI burn and Ecliptic North pole defining the ZX plane. PRMBURN orientation has +Z along the reference direction during the PRM burn and Ecliptic North pole defining the ZX plane. DEORBITBURN orientation has +Z along the reference direction during the DEORBIT burn and Ecliptic North pole defining the ZX plane.
